What is the Volunteer Personal and Medical Information Form?
The Volunteer Personal and Medical Information Form is critical for state disaster relief directors to gather essential personal and medical details from potential volunteers. This form's significance lies in its structured collection of data, allowing efficient management of volunteer readiness and safety during disaster response efforts. Information captured includes personal profiles, emergency contacts, and health-related details, reinforcing the importance of ensuring that volunteers are well-prepared for their roles.

Key Features of the Volunteer Personal and Medical Information Form
This form includes several key sections that facilitate comprehensive data gathering:
-
Personal profile information to identify the volunteer
-
Emergency contact details for quick communication
-
Health information necessary for assessing volunteer capabilities
Designed for user convenience, the form features multiple fillable fields and checkboxes, making it easier to complete and submit.

Who should fill out the Volunteer Personal and Medical Information Form?
Individuals who wish to volunteer for disaster relief efforts should fill out this form, including both general volunteers and specialized professionals like health workers.
Are there deadlines for submitting this form?
While specific deadlines may vary by organization, it is recommended to submit the form as early as possible to ensure timely processing before a disaster response.
How do I submit the form after completing it?
After completing the form, you can submit it via email or upload it to the designated portal provided by the disaster relief organization you are volunteering with.
What supporting documents do I need to include with this form?
Typically, no additional documents are required, but check with the organization for any specific requirements regarding identification or certifications.
What are some common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, providing incorrect emergency contact information, or failing to update health conditions. Review all entries carefully.
How long does it take for my application to be processed?
Processing times may vary, but usually, you should receive confirmation or additional information within a week after submission.
Is there a fee associated with submitting the Volunteer Personal and Medical Information Form?
No, there are typically no fees associated with submitting this form for volunteer purposes.
